QUARTET

The Bristol based “Eastern Strings” features compositions by Daphna Sadeh on double bass and Knud Stüwe on the oud. Their music is a tapestry of Classical music elements , World music and Jazz improvisation. In 2019 they released a new album, Climbing the Summit , on UK lable 33 Records. The album was featured on Radio BBC 3. 

This quartet features Daan Temmink on accordeon and piano, who is is a UK based film & TV composer, jazz pianist and session musician. Since 2016 he has collaborated with Andrew Lawson, composing music for Sizzer Amsterdam and other music agencies. 

 

Mark Whitlam also features on drums. Mark's versatility opened up opportunities to perform in many genres, from Mercury Prize nominee and BBC Folk Award winner Eliza Carthy to experimental jazz ECM-label artists Andy Sheppard and Iain Ballamy
